2004 Metro Conference championships

Barons, Titans dominate Metro finals

 

By Phillip Brents
Posted May 20, 2004


At the conclusion of this year’s Metro Conference swimming championships, a suggestion was made to split future meets into a two divisional format. The idea would be to allow for more recognition between athletes from the Mesa League and South Bay League.


After the dominating performance put on by swimmers from Mesa League powers Bonita Vista and Eastlake at last Saturday’s conference finals, that might not be such a bad idea.


The Barons (16) and Titans (7) combined to win 23 of 24 events at this year’s conference finals, including the diving competition and both the boys and girls ends of the swim meet.


Bonita Vista captured titles in all 11 boys and girls championship swimming finals (top eight finishers in each event).


Bonita Vista’s Chris Lopez (boys 200-yard freestyle and 100-yard backstroke), Chris Lopez (50-yard freestyle and 100-yard freestyle), Katie Leahy (girls 200-yard freestyle and 100-yard backstroke) and Alvizia Alexander (200-yard individual medley and 100-yard butterfly) each captured two individual events. Other Baron event winners included Carlos Escaba (boys 500-yard freestyle), Sasha Beltran (girls 100-yard freestyle) and Brittany Estrada (girls 500-yard freestyle).


Bonita Vista captured titles in five of the six relays at this year’s finals, sweeping the boys 200-yard medley, 200-yard freestyle and 400-yard freestyle relays while winning the girls 200 and 400 freestyle distances. The Baron team of Beltran, Jeanette Islas, Berenice Jimenez and Estrada set a new school record (1:45.48) in the 200 free relay.
Bonita Vista’s Lopez and Alexander were named the Metro Conference male and female Swimmers of the Year, respectively.


Hilltop senior Kyle Kovar (boys diving) was the lone South Bay League swimmer to win an individual title at this year’s championship weekend.


In combined team points (boys and girls), the Metro Conference’s strength was divided as follows: Bonita Vista (976 points), Eastlake (622), Mar Vista (549), Hilltop (471), Montgomery (225), Otay Ranch (146), Southwest (103), Marian Catholic (101), Chula Vista (66), Castle Park (53) and Sweetwater (27).


Individually, Mesa League swimmers captured the top six of eight finishing positions in the boys 200 free, the top five finishing positions in the girls 100 breaststroke and the top four finishing positions in the girls 50 free and 500 free, boys 100 backstroke and boys 100 breaststroke.


The top three finishers in the boys 200 free all belonged to Bonita Vista: Sanchez, Nicko Marshall and Gabriel Gonzalez. Beto Vasquez was fifth in the event, giving the Barons four of the top five finishers.


Eastlake swept the top two positions in the girls breaststroke, with sophomore Dani Kimmel (also the meet’s girls 50 free champion) leading teammate Andrea Williamson to the touch pad.


Eastlake freshman Marc Uy (boys 200 IM and 100 breaststroke) matched Kimmel with two individual championships. Ashley Perez (girls diving) and Tom Dziadkoweic (boys 100 butterfly) rounded out the Titans’ four individual champions (including six individual events).


The Mesa League’s superior depth also extended to the consolation championships (ninth through 16th places) as Mesa League swimmers captured seven of 16 individual first-place finishes. Overall, the Mesa League won 29 of the 38 contested races (76 percent) at last weekend’s finals, championship and consolation heats combined.


In advance of next year’s potential league finals split, the South Bay League did select its all-league first team for this season based on conference championship heat finish. Dual meet champion Mar Vista dominated the swimming events, capturing 15 of the 23 first team positions. Hilltop had six first team all-league positions, followed by one each from Otay Ranch and Southwest.


Mar Vista’s Don Sales (first in league in both the 200 IM and 100 butterfly) was named South Bay League Boys Swimmer of the Year while Mar Vista’s Meredith Moses (first in league in both the 200 IM and 100 backstroke) was named South Bay League Girls Swimmer of the Year.


Overall, Sales finished second in the conference in both events while Moses was second overall in the breaststroke and fourth in the individual medley.


Mar Vista’s Scott Knox (boys 50 free and 100 free) and Julian Czerwiec (boys 200 free and 100 backstroke) both earned first team All-South Bay League honors in two individual events.  Knox finished third in both events in the conference field.


Mar Vista’s other first team all-league swimmers included Jennifer Parra (girls 200 free), Kristi Hall (girls 50 free) and Devon Love (100 breaststroke).


Rounding out the South Bay League All-League First Team are Hilltop’s Kyle Kovar (boys diving, 500 free), Ashley Sandoval (girls 100 butterfly) and Andrea Meier (girls 100 free), Otay Ranch’s Elyse Dayrit (girls 500 free) and Southwest’s D.J. Figueroa (boys 100 breaststroke).


Overall, Kovar finished first in diving and third in the 500 free; Sandoval was third in the butterfly stroke.
